> Why won't they just be z39.50 diagnostics? We've got no interoperability
> otherwise. If we need to add new ones to z39.50, then that's fine. But
> let's not just start over with a new set.
So will the soap Fault code be something like, in SOAP 1.1:
<Envelope>
<Body>
<Fault>
<faultcode>z39.50:6</faultcode>
<faultstring>Too many boolean operators</faultstring>
</Fault>
</Body>
</Envelope>
The faultcode value has to be a qualified name. Which means that we also
need a namespace for z39.50 diagnostics, and SRW diagnostics. (As far as I
understand it)
(And of course is different in SOAP 1.2)
